The Cathedral of St. John the Evangelist is a stunning display of architecture, history and spirituality. This South Hill landmark features Gothic-style design made in sandstone which was completed in 1969. When you step inside, you will be immediately struck by the stained-glass windows that all feature various Biblical scenes, as well as the various carvings inside that illustrate the history of the church. Tours are offered four days a week, but if you decide to take the tour on Thursday, you will also be able to hear the awe-inspiring sound of the cathedral's weekly 49-bell carillon concert.

The Spokane Civic Theatre boasts an impressive vintage. Originally constructed in the late 1940s, the venue still offers some of the city's most respected theatrical productions that include critically lauded comedies, musicals, and dramas. Every season is filled with must-see performances and entertainment, so make sure you get your tickets early. The theater also features two main seating areas. Enjoy the action on stage from the Main Stage for a more panoramic view, or see it from a more intimate perspective when you sit in the Studio Theatre.
